The serous fluid within the pericardial cavity works to:____.

Biology
1 answer:
Feliz [49]3 years ago
6 0

The serous fluid within the pericardial cavity works to lubricate the membranes of the serous pericardium. It is the space between the layers of the pericardium.

<h3>What is the pericardial cavity?</h3>

The pericardial cavity refers to the space between different layers of the pericardium in the heart.

The pericardium is one of the three tissues that form the heart (i.e., pericardium, myocardium, and endocardium).

The pericardial cavity is composed of a serous fluid capable of reducing surface tension and lubricating this layer.
